狗狗币在TPWallet上的落地:从存储到智能化数据协同的案例透视

导语:本案例以一家中小型支付实验室在TPWallet中接入狗狗币(DOGE)并扩展智能合约与私密数据管理为线索,剖析技术路径与运营流程。

场景与挑战:TPWallet原生支持UTXO类资产的存储与转账,但狗狗币本身缺乏复杂合约能力。团队希望既能接收DOGE支付,又能在DApp中触发合约逻辑、保护用户隐私并实现轻量节点校验。

解决方案概览:采用跨链包装(wrapped DOGE)与中继合约,将DOGE映射为EVM兼容代币以使用智能合约;敏感用户数据采用本地密钥加密并上链引用指针,实际数据托管于去中心化存储(IPFS/Arweave)或可信执行环境。

私密数据与便捷保护流程:1)用户在TPWallet生成助记词与本地密钥库(Secure Enclave或Keystore)并支持生物解锁;2)敏感数据被客户端加密,产生内容地址(CID);3)CID与访问策略(时限、多签)通过合约或链下策略记录,钱包持有解密密钥片段并可通过门限签名恢复。

节点钱包与技术观察:TPWallet可运行轻节点或通过可信RPC池连接全节点以检索UTXO与验证交易。案例中采用轻节点+服务端验证组合,降低移动端负担同时防止单点信任。技术观察显示,桥接合约需关注跨链最终性、重放保护与流动性风险。

智能合约与智能数据:合约层实现支付路由、托管条件与数据访问控制逻辑;智能数据指结构化元数据与访问策略的链上表达,便于审计与可组合应用。通过事件与索引服务,DApp能在接收DOGE后触发业务流程(如发货、授信)并基于链上日志做证明。

流程总结(逐步):1. 用户在TPWallet接收DOGE;2. 若需合约交互,用户发起桥接交易生成wDOGE;3. wDOGE调用智能合约触发业务逻辑;4. 私密数据本地加密并上链存指;5. 节点/索引服务同步并完成验证与结算;6. 恢复与备份通过阈值密钥与助记词完成。

结语:本案例证明,通过包装与跨链、客户端加密与去中心化存储、以及轻节点策略,TPWallet可在保留DOGE资产特点的同时扩展智能合约与私密数据能力。关键在于兼顾用户体验、密钥治理与跨链安全,才能把“狗狗币的钱包”变成一个兼容性强、隐私友好的区块链应用平台。

作者:林墨言发布时间:2026-01-11 12:25:59

相关阅读